Remote Position: Clinical Care Configuration Analyst
Location: Any location within the US
Duration: FTE / Permanent
Salary: $72,000 – $89,000
Summary
The ideal candidate will perform analysis, design, and maintenance of the Clinical Care Advance system and other assigned platforms. You will serve as a subject matter expert, identifying and resolving configuration issues, recommending improvements, and ensuring high-quality deliverables. This role involves providing recommendations for vendor system enhancements, testing delivered features, and integrating them into ongoing configuration strategies.
Required Skills, Experience & Education
- Education: Bachelor's degree in business or a healthcare-related field (equivalent education/experience considered).
- Experience:
- Minimum 5 years in Systems Configuration, Claims, or Operations within a healthcare organization.
- 2 to 5 years of experience with clinical and care management systems (e.g., CareAdvance Enterprise Application).
- Working knowledge of enterprise systems such as Facets.
- Knowledge:
- Advanced knowledge of health plan configuration (healthcare services, medical management, population health management).
- Familiarity with industry care guidelines (e.g., Milliman Care Guidelines).
- Understanding of configuration change management methodologies and best practices.
- Project Management: Ability to manage projects independently from end to end.
- Analytical Skills: Ability to analyze processes, document workflows, perform gap analysis, and develop future-state standardized workflows.
Daily Responsibilities
- Gather requirements, perform analysis, and develop configuration designs to meet business needs.
- Manage complex system configuration and related documentation.
- Serve as a subject matter expert for configuration change management testing and best practices.
- Facilitate production controls and system configuration data codification.
- Monitor system edits and conduct advanced root cause analysis to identify issues and provide resolution recommendations.
- Identify and implement process improvements.
- Collaborate with Healthcare Services and the broader organization to support configuration management life cycle.
- Support project plans and track configuration changes, operational issues, and resolutions.
- Represent the team on internal and external committees.
- Provide system-based recommendations for enhancement requests.
- Lead configuration project timelines to meet deliverables.
- Coordinate the preparation and execution of test plans to validate configuration updates and system fixes.
